Airports in Milan

Milan Malpensa Airport (MXP)

  • Milan Malpensa Airport (MXP) is around 48 kilometres from the centre of Milan. If you're getting a taxi or a ride-share, the drive takes roughly 50 minutes.

  • If you're travelling by public transport, expect a journey time of around 50 minutes.

Milano Linate Airport (LIN)

  • Milano Linate Airport (LIN) is around 8 kilometres from central Milan. It takes about 20 minutes to reach the city centre in a taxi or ride-share after your flight from Dubai International Airport to Milan.

  • The journey will take you around 30 minutes by public transport.

Explore more of Italy

  • Rome is just one of the many cities in Italy waiting to be discovered after you've experienced Milan. Around 483 kilometres away to the southeast, its best attractions include Vatican Museums, St. Peter's Basilica and Saint Peter's Square.

  • Turin is another must-experience destination in Italy and is around 129 kilometres west of Milan. No trip is complete without a visit to Museo Nazionale del Cinema, Juventus Museum and Duomo di Torino e Cappella della Sacra Sindone.
